 Creamy Cucumber Shrimp Salad

Ingredients:

  • 1 lb cooked shrimp, peeled & deveined (small or medium size works best)

  • 1 large cucumber, thinly sliced (peeled or unpeeled)

  • ¼ red onion, thinly sliced or diced

  • 2 tbsp fresh dill, chopped (or 1 tsp dried)

  • 1–2 stalks celery, thinly sliced (optional for crunch)

  • Salt & black pepper, to taste

For the Creamy Dressing:

  • ½ cup sour cream (or Greek yogurt)

  • 2 tbsp mayonnaise

  • 1 tbsp lemon juice

  • 1 tsp Dijon mustard

  • 1 clove garlic, minced

  • Salt & pepper, to taste


Instructions:

  1. Prep the cucumber:

    • Toss the cucumber slices with a pinch of salt and let sit in a colander for 15–20 minutes to draw out excess moisture. Pat dry.

  2. Mix the dressing:

    • In a bowl, whisk together sour cream, mayo, lemon juice, mustard, garlic, salt & pepper.

  3. Combine salad:

    • In a large bowl, gently mix shrimp, cucumber, red onion, celery, and dill.

    • Pour the dressing over and toss to coat evenly.

  4. Chill:

    • Refrigerate for 30–60 minutes before serving so the flavors meld.

  5. Serve:

    • Great on its own, in lettuce cups, or scooped onto croissants, toast, or crackers.
